For this card I used the Close To My Heart Thriller set. To obtain the “grunge” look for the background, I used Ranger’s Alcohol Ink and the Alcohol Blending solution. I mixed these together on a blending sponge and made quick dabs all over the cardstock. Once the cardstock was covered in color, I added the blending solution to the sponge and made quick dabs all over the cardstock. This blended all of the ink and made the colors look more cohesive. Once I achieved the look I was aiming for, I then sprayed the cardstock with the Black Soot Distress Spray to darken up the background a bit.
I stamped the sentiment “scary Halloween to you” on cardstock that I distressed with the Frayed Burlap Distress Ink. To finish the card up, I added a few sequins to the sentiment and the background from the Crafty Pickle Relish Mix.
